LECTURE OUTLINE AND LEARNING OBJECTIVES
1) Introduction
 

  1. Review of objectives and requirements of the course.
  2. Introduction to all endodontic forms to be used in the clinic.
  3. Documentation of procedures and treatment.
  4. Clinical Protocol.

 
2) Clinical Diagnostic Procedures
 

  1. Chief complaint, medical and dental history.
  2. Examination and testing.
  • Pulp test
  • Special test
  • Radiographic examination and interpretation.
  • Root fracture
  • Referred pain
  1. Clinical classification of  pulpal and periradicular diseases.
  2. Treatment planning and case selection.

 
3) Clinical Endodontics I
 

  1. patient preparation.
  2. preparation of radiographs.
  3. Preparation for access: Tooth isolation.

4) Clinical Endodontics II
 

  1. Access cavity preparation.
  • Objective and guidelines for access cavity preparation.
  • Mechanical phases of access cavity preparation.
  • Error in access cavity preparation.
  • Morphology and access cavity preparation for individual teeth.
  1. Length determination.
  • Radiographic
  • Electronic apex locator.

 
5) Clinical Endodontics III
 

  1. Cleaning and shaping of root canal system
  2. Obturation of the cleaned and shaped root canal system
  3. Temporization of endodontically treated tooth.

6) Restoration of endodontically treated tooth
a) Special features of endodontically treated teeth.
b) Restorative materials and options.
c) Pretreatment evaluation and treatment strategy.
7) Nonsurgical Retreatment
a) Etiology of posttreatment disease.
b) Diagnosis of posttreatment disease.
c) Treatment planning.
d) Nonsurgical endodontic retreatment.
 
8) Management of Endodontic Emergencies
a) Emergency classifications.
b) Emergency endodontic management.
c) Analgesics and antibiotics.
d) Cracked and fractured teeth.
 
9) The Role of Endodontics After Dental Traumatic Injuries
a) Classification – World Health Organization.
b) Radiographic examination.
c) Clinical management.
d) Follow-up after dental trauma.
 
10) Periradicular Surgery
 

  1. Indications for periradicular surgery.
  2. Periradicular surgery.
  3. Postoperative care.

 
 
11) Endodontic and Periodontal Interrelationships
 

  1. Influence of pulpal pathologic condition on the periodontium.
  2. Influence of periodontal inflammation on the pulp.
  3. Differential diagnosis.
  4. Treatment alternatives.

 
12) Discoloration and Bleaching
 

  1. Causes of tooth discoloration.
  2. Contraindications to bleaching.
  3. Methods of bleaching discolored teeth:
  4. Veneering discolored teeth.

 
13) Prognosis of Root Canal Therapy
 

  1. Describe the importance of recall.
  2. Describe modalities used to determine success and failure.
  3. Factors determine success and failure.
  4. Identify causes other than endodontic that may lead to failure.

 
14) Regenerative Endodontics
 

  1. Overview of Regenerative Endodontics
  2. Summary of Basic Research on Regenerative Endodontics
  3. Clinical Procedures Related to Regenerative Endodontics
